How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Ocean Park?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Ocean Park Studio Apartments | $2,087 | $1,298 | $2,700 |
| Ocean Park 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,281 | $2,250 | $6,015 |
| Ocean Park 2 Bedroom Apartments | $4,064 | $2,800 | $6,525 |
| Ocean Park 3 Bedroom Apartments | $5,938 | $5,099 | $7,350 |
| Ocean Park 4 Bedroom Apartments | $6,995 | $6,995 | $6,995 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Gated Ocean Park Apartments
What is the Cheapest Gated apartment in Ocean Park?
Currently the most affordable Gated Apartment in Ocean Park is at 2913 2nd St, Unit 2911 - Front listed at $1,795.
How much is the average rent for a Gated Ocean Park Apartment?
The average rent for a Gated Apartment in Ocean Park is $3,622.
What is the largest Gated Ocean Park Apartment for rent?
Today's Gated apartment with the most square footage in Ocean Park is a 2,000 square feet unit starting from $6,995 at 3110 Highland Ave, Unit Duplex.
What is the average size for Ocean Park Gated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Gated rental in Ocean Park is currently at 711 sq ft.
